Pseudocode ist ein Werkzeug, das von Computerprogrammierern verwendet wird, um Algorithmen in einer prägnanten und strukturierten Weise auszudrücken. Es ist eine Möglichkeit, ein Programm in einer für den Menschen lesbaren Weise zu beschreiben, ohne tatsächlich Code in einer bestimmten Sprache schreiben zu müssen. Pseudocode wird manchmal auch als "Programmieren in einfachem Englisch" bezeichnet, da er oft in einer Sprache geschrieben wird, die dem Englischen ähnlich ist.
Pseudocode hat eine Reihe von Vorteilen, die ihn zu einem unschätzbaren Werkzeug für Computerprogrammierer machen. Erstens ermöglicht es dem Programmierer, seine Ideen schnell, klar und methodisch auszudrücken. Zweitens kann der Programmierer damit seine Ideen testen, ohne den langwierigen Prozess der Codeerstellung durchlaufen zu müssen. Und schließlich kann der Programmierer ein Dokument erstellen, mit dem er anderen sein Programm erklären kann.
Pseudocode wird oft als eine "Programmiersprache im Klartext" beschrieben, da er eine Kombination aus natürlicher Sprache und Programmierkonventionen verwendet. Pseudocode hat eine Reihe von Merkmalen, die ihn von anderen Programmiersprachen unterscheiden. Dazu gehören die Verwendung einer einfachen, leicht verständlichen Sprache, das Fehlen einer Syntax und die Fähigkeit, komplexe Algorithmen auf prägnante Weise auszudrücken.
Das Schreiben von Pseudocode ist eine Fähigkeit, die erlernt und geübt werden muss, um effektiv genutzt werden zu können. Der Prozess des Schreibens von Pseudocode wird oft als ähnlich wie das Schreiben einer Geschichte beschrieben, wobei jede Zeile des Pseudocodes einen Satz in der Geschichte darstellt. Pseudocode sollte in einer präzisen und strukturierten Weise geschrieben werden, um sicherzustellen, dass die Ideen des Programmierers klar ausgedrückt werden.
Es gibt eine Reihe von Tipps, die das Schreiben von Pseudocode einfacher und effizienter machen können. Erstens ist es wichtig, einen komplexen Algorithmus in kleinere, besser handhabbare Teile zu zerlegen. Zweitens ist es wichtig, dass die verwendete Sprache klar und prägnant ist. Und schließlich ist es wichtig, dass der Pseudocode für andere leicht lesbar und verständlich ist.
Pseudocode kann verwendet werden, um eine breite Palette von Algorithmen auszudrücken, von einfachen Sortieralgorithmen bis zu komplexen neuronalen Netzen. Beispiele für Pseudocode finden sich im Internet, in Lehrbüchern und in Tutorials zu Programmiersprachen. Es ist wichtig, diese Beispiele zu studieren, um ein besseres Verständnis für die Sprache und die Struktur von Pseudocode zu erlangen.
Beim Schreiben von Pseudocode ist es wichtig, bestimmte Syntax und Konventionen einzuhalten, um sicherzustellen, dass der Pseudocode leicht lesbar und für andere verständlich ist. Zu den üblichen Syntax und Konventionen gehören die Verwendung von Einrückungen zur Kennzeichnung der Struktur, die Verwendung von Großbuchstaben für Konstanten und die Verwendung von Kommentaren zur Erläuterung eines bestimmten Codeabschnitts.
Sobald ein Programmierer mit der Syntax und den Konventionen von Pseudocode vertraut ist, kann er damit beginnen, ihn in seinen Programmierprojekten zu verwenden. Pseudocode kann verwendet werden, um Algorithmen auszudrücken und ein Dokument zu erstellen, das dazu verwendet werden kann, anderen das Programm zu erklären. Er kann auch verwendet werden, um schnell einen groben Entwurf eines Programms zu erstellen, bevor der Programmierer mit der Programmierung beginnt.